"Time Travel" - The David Bezhuashvili Collection

The joint projects of the David Bezhuashvili Education Foundation and the Multi-Industry Holding GIG are well known to the public, especially among the business sector, Georgian and international partners. These initiatives represent the foundation’s and the holding’s commitment to social responsibility. In 2024, we are proud to present the book “Time Travel: The David Bezhuashvili Collection”, bringing together three major projects we have undertaken in recent years. This book serves as a reflection of our work– what we are doing.

 

From rescuing and rehabilitating rare artifacts, ancient books, and archaeological treasures to purchasing valuable collections for museums and creating new exhibition spaces, our mission has been driven by a deep sense of social responsibility...

 

One of our landmark achievements was the creation of the “Book Museum” in Tbilisi, a long-held dream of the National Library that became a reality thanks to the foundation’s support. Dubbed the “Project of the Century” and the largest book museum in the region,” this initiative brought to light 15,000 ancient books, including rare and unique editions, the first printed books, and dictionaries.

 

Another significant journey took us to the National Museum, where we revitalized the “Caucasus Biodiversity” exhibition space. This collection dates back to the 19th century but had been locked away during the Soviet era. Thanks to the museum’s efforts and the foundation’s support, these extraordinary and rare exhibits have returned to public view. The exhibition was enhanced with modern technology, making it an interactive and dynamic space where children now gather daily for lessons in biology, nature, zoology, and geography.

 

Meanwhile, at the Palace of Arts, a dedicated section now showcases the David Bezhuashvili Collection—a decision made by the museum itself. These carefully restored artifacts, many of which were saved from being taken out of the country, are now part of the museum’s permanent display. Over 200 museum pieces were acquired and preserved thanks to the foundation’s efforts.
